<h3>The Oxygen-Carbon Dioxide Balance</h3>
<p>Most people believe that breathing is primarily about getting more oxygen into the body, but the relationship between oxygen and carbon dioxide is more nuanced than that. Carbon dioxide isn&#8217;t just a waste product—it plays a critical role in oxygen delivery to our cells through what&#8217;s known as the Bohr effect. When we breathe too rapidly or shallowly (a common response to stress), we actually reduce carbon dioxide levels too much, which paradoxically makes it harder for oxygen to be released from hemoglobin into our tissues.</p>
<p>Proper breathing techniques help maintain optimal carbon dioxide levels, ensuring efficient oxygen delivery throughout the body. This is why techniques like box breathing, alternate nostril breathing, and extended exhalations can have such profound effects on energy levels, mental clarity, and physical performance.</p>

<h3>Diaphragmatic Breathing</h3>
<p>Also known as belly breathing, this foundational technique involves breathing deeply into the abdomen rather than shallowly into the chest. Place one hand on your chest and another on your belly. As you inhale, your belly should rise while your chest remains relatively still. This activates the diaphragm fully, maximizing oxygen exchange and promoting relaxation.</p>
<h3>Box Breathing</h3>
<p>Used by Navy SEALs and elite athletes, box breathing involves equal counts for inhale, hold, exhale, and hold—typically four counts each. This technique is particularly effective for managing acute stress and enhancing focus. The balanced rhythm promotes nervous system equilibrium and mental clarity.</p>
<h3>4-7-8 Breathing</h3>
<p>Developed by Dr. Andrew Weil, this technique involves inhaling for 4 counts, holding for 7 counts, and exhaling for 8 counts. The extended exhalation activates the parasympathetic nervous system, making this practice especially valuable for reducing anxiety and promoting sleep.</p>
<h3>Alternate Nostril Breathing</h3>
<p>This yogic practice (Nadi Shodhana) involves alternating breathing through each nostril. Research suggests this technique can help balance the hemispheres of the brain, reduce stress, and improve respiratory function. It&#8217;s particularly beneficial for calming an overactive mind.</p>

<h3>Nadi Shodhana: The Channel Purification Breath</h3>
<p>Also known as alternate nostril breathing, Nadi Shodhana is perhaps one of the most studied pranayama techniques. Practitioners alternately close one nostril while breathing through the other, creating a balanced rhythm between the left and right nasal passages. This practice is traditionally believed to purify the subtle energy channels of the body.</p>
<p>The technique involves using the thumb to close the right nostril while inhaling through the left, then closing the left nostril with the ring finger while exhaling through the right. The pattern continues, creating a complete cycle that balances the nervous system and promotes mental clarity.</p>
<h3>Ujjayi: The Victorious Breath</h3>
<p>Ujjayi pranayama involves slightly constricting the throat while breathing, creating a soft ocean-like sound. This technique generates internal heat, focuses attention, and regulates the breath rate. It&#8217;s commonly practiced during physical yoga asanas but can also be performed independently for its calming and centering effects.</p>
<h3>Kapalabhati: The Skull-Shining Breath</h3>
<p>This energizing technique consists of forceful exhalations through the nose, with passive inhalations occurring naturally. The abdominal muscles contract powerfully with each exhalation, creating a pumping action. Kapalabhati is considered a cleansing practice that increases oxygen delivery to tissues and stimulates the digestive fire.</p>
<h3>Bhramari: The Humming Bee Breath</h3>
<p>In Bhramari pranayama, practitioners create a humming sound during exhalation, similar to the buzzing of a bee. This vibration has profound effects on the nervous system and is particularly effective for anxiety reduction and mental tranquility. The sound creates a soothing resonance throughout the skull and brain.</p>

<h3>Kumbhaka: The Yogic Foundation</h3>
<p>In yogic traditions, breath retention is called kumbhaka, which translates to &#8220;pot&#8221; or &#8220;vessel&#8221;—suggesting the body holds the breath like a container holds water. There are two primary forms: antara kumbhaka (retention after inhalation) and bahya kumbhaka (retention after exhalation).</p>
<p>Antara kumbhaka involves filling your lungs completely, then holding the breath with lungs full. This technique increases oxygen saturation initially and creates a powerful energizing effect. It&#8217;s particularly useful for enhancing alertness and preparing your mind for demanding cognitive tasks.</p>
<p>Bahya kumbhaka, holding the breath after a complete exhalation, creates a different physiological response. With empty lungs, the body experiences a more intense urge to breathe, which strengthens your mental discipline and activates deeper parasympathetic responses. This variation is excellent for developing focus and emotional regulation.</p>
<h3>Box Breathing with Retention</h3>
<p>Box breathing, also known as square breathing, incorporates equal-length phases of inhalation, retention, exhalation, and post-exhale retention. Navy SEALs and tactical operators use this technique to maintain clarity under extreme pressure.</p>
<p>A typical pattern involves breathing in for four counts, holding for four counts, exhaling for four counts, and holding empty for four counts. This creates a balanced approach that stabilizes your nervous system while providing cognitive benefits. You can adjust the count duration as your capacity improves, working up to six or eight counts per phase.</p>
<h3>Wim Hof Method: Cyclic Hyperventilation and Retention</h3>
<p>The Wim Hof Method has gained significant popularity for its dramatic effects on both physical and mental performance. This technique involves cycles of rapid, deep breathing followed by extended breath retention on the exhale.</p>
<p>After 30-40 powerful breaths, practitioners exhale and hold their breath for as long as comfortable—often reaching 1-3 minutes even for beginners. This creates a unique state where oxygen saturation is high but CO2 is depleted, allowing for extended comfortable retention. The subsequent recovery breath and brief retention floods the system with oxygen, creating a profound state of mental clarity.</p>

<h3>Resonance and Entrainment Explained</h3>
<p>Two fundamental principles govern how sound affects our bodies: resonance and entrainment. Resonance occurs when an external vibration matches the natural frequency of an object, causing it to vibrate sympathetically. Every organ in your body has its own resonant frequency—your heart, lungs, brain, and even individual cells respond to specific vibrational patterns.</p>
<p>Entrainment describes the process by which two rhythmic systems synchronize with each other. Your heartbeat, for instance, will naturally begin to match a consistent external rhythm when exposed to it over time. This phenomenon explains why calming music can slow your heart rate or why an energetic drumbeat makes you want to move.</p>

<h3>Measuring What Cannot Be Seen 👁️</h3>
<p>The challenge of measuring invisible energy fields has driven countless innovations in instrumentation and methodology. Modern sensors can detect minute changes in electromagnetic radiation, gravitational distortions, or quantum fluctuations with extraordinary precision.</p>
<p>Magnetometers measure magnetic field strength and direction, finding applications ranging from geological surveys to medical diagnostics. Superconducting quantum interference devices (SQUIDs) achieve sensitivity levels capable of detecting the tiny magnetic fields produced by neural activity in the human brain.</p>
<p>Spectrometers analyze the electromagnetic spectrum across different wavelengths, revealing the composition of distant stars, identifying chemical compounds, or diagnosing medical conditions. These instruments transform invisible radiation into interpretable data that drives scientific discovery.</p>
<p>Electric field sensors detect variations in electrical potential, essential for applications from weather prediction to cardiac monitoring. The electrocardiogram (ECG), a routine medical test, essentially measures the electrical field generated by the heart&#8217;s rhythmic contractions.</p>

<h2>🌟 Practical Applications Across Industries</h2>
<p>Energy field measurement technologies permeate modern industry, often invisibly supporting critical functions. Understanding these applications illustrates the practical value of detecting the invisible.</p>
<p>In manufacturing, non-destructive testing using electromagnetic fields detects internal defects in materials without damaging products. Eddy current testing identifies cracks in aircraft components, while magnetic particle inspection reveals surface and near-surface discontinuities in ferromagnetic materials.</p>
<p>Security systems employ various energy field sensors to detect intrusions or prohibited items. Metal detectors sense electromagnetic field distortions caused by conductive objects, while millimeter-wave scanners create images through clothing using reflected radiation.</p>
<p>Environmental monitoring networks track pollution levels, radiation exposure, and electromagnetic interference. These systems protect public health by identifying hazardous conditions and ensuring regulatory compliance.</p>
<h3>Agricultural and Ecological Applications 🌱</h3>
<p>Energy field measurements contribute to sustainable agriculture and ecosystem management. Remote sensing satellites measure reflected electromagnetic radiation to assess crop health, soil moisture, and vegetation coverage across vast areas.</p>
<p>Ground-penetrating radar uses electromagnetic waves to image subsurface structures without excavation. Archaeologists employ this technique to locate buried artifacts, while farmers map underground water resources or drainage issues.</p>
<p>Wildlife tracking increasingly uses biotelemetry devices that transmit electromagnetic signals revealing animal locations, movements, and even physiological states. This data informs conservation strategies and ecological research.</p>

<h2>Box Breathing: The Foundation of Focus 📦</h2>
<p>Box breathing, also known as square breathing, is perhaps the most accessible and immediately effective technique for enhancing concentration. Navy SEALs use this method to maintain composure and mental clarity in high-pressure situations, and you can apply it to transform your work sessions.</p>
<p>The technique is beautifully simple: inhale for four counts, hold for four counts, exhale for four counts, and hold empty for four counts. This creates a &#8220;box&#8221; pattern that balances your nervous system and anchors your attention in the present moment.</p>
<p>To practice box breathing for productivity, sit comfortably before beginning a challenging task. Close your eyes and complete five to ten rounds of the box pattern. Notice how your mind becomes clearer and your body more relaxed yet alert. This state is ideal for deep work that requires sustained concentration.</p>
<p>The power of box breathing lies in its ability to interrupt stress patterns while simultaneously activating focus circuits in your brain. The equal timing creates neural coherence, while the breath holds increase carbon dioxide tolerance, which paradoxically improves oxygen utilization at the cellular level.</p>
